Bali is an Indonesian island well-known for its volcanic mountains, coral reefs, and sandy beaches. The island is also home to various cultures, religions, and languages—many interesting places to visit in Bali, including ancient temples, beautiful villages, and secluded beaches.

Bali is a world-famous tourist destination, and for a good reason. With its stunning scenery, varied culture, delicious food, and welcoming people, there’s something for everyone in this beautiful country. Here are just a few of the many places worth visiting in Bali.

Here are the best places to visit in Bali

Bali is an Indonesian island located at the westernmost end of the Lesser Sunda Islands. It is one of the country’s 33 provinces with the provincial capital at Denpasar. Bali is home to a vast array of tourist attractions. Many places to visit in Bali, such as ancient temples, pristine beaches, lush rice fields, and towering volcanoes.

Ubud – One of the best places to visit in Bali

Firstly, Ubud, located in the heart of the island of Bali, Indonesia, is a town well-known for its arts and culture. The many art galleries, yoga studios, and massage parlors make it a popular tourist destination for those looking to experience Bali’s “spiritual side.”

Ubud - places to visit in bali
Image by wendy saputa from Pixabay

Ubud is also surrounded by rice paddies and jungle, making it beautiful and peaceful. It is recommended to visit Ubud during the dry season from November to March.

Tanah Lot- One of the best places to visit in Bali

Secondly, Tanah Lot Temple is a Balinese Hindu temple located on a rock island in the middle of the sea; it is also one of Bali’s most popular tourist destinations. The temple was built in the 16th century by the Javanese priest Danghyang Nirartha, the founder of modern Balinese Hinduism. Tanah Lot means “Land [of] the Sea” in Balinese.

The temple is also surrounded by a coral reef and a small coral island. The main sea view of Tanah Lot Temple can be seen from the “Villa Ahimsa” restaurant, which is located near the cliff with a rock bridge that looks down on the beach and temple.

Seminyak – Bali beautiful places

Thirdly, Seminyak is a town on the Indonesian island of Bali. It is well-known for its high-end shopping and dining, as well as its nightlife. Seminyak is a popular tourist destination, especially among Australians and Singaporeans. The town is located about 10 kilometers north of Denpasar, the capital of Bali. Seminyak has a population of about 33,000 people.

Seminyak - bali beautiful places
Image by hartono subagio from Pixabay

The beach in Seminyak is a popular place for tourists to enjoy swimming, sunbathing, and surfing. At the southern end of this stretch of beach lies Kuta Beach, the preferred resort area for many international tourists.

Pura Besakih – One of theBali beautiful places

Besakih is the most sacred temple of the Hindu religion on the island of Bali. The temple is located in Besakih Village, Rendang sub-district, Karangasem Regency. It is set on the slope of Mount Agung, the highest mountain in Bali. The temple complex consists of six courtyards (Pura), each shrine.

Pura Besakih - best places to visit in bali
Photo by Andrey Bond on Unsplash

The main sanctuary is located in the middle of the complex, on a hilltop above the others. The temple was founded in 1283 and was renovated by King Agung of Bali in 1616.

Kuta Beach

Lastly, Kuta Beach is one of the most popular tourist destinations in Bali. The white sand and gentle waves make it a perfect place to relax, and the many restaurants and bars make it a great place to socialize. Kuta Beach is also a great place to learn to surf, and many schools offer lessons.

The beach is located on the west side of Kuta, and there are many hotels and resorts around it. It has become a very popular surfing location because of its consistent waves from the Indian Ocean.


In conclusion, there are many amazing places to visit in Bali. With its rich culture and stunning landscape, it is a must-see destination for any traveler. Bali has something for everyone, whether you are looking for a relaxing beach vacation or an adventure-filled holiday.

So what are you waiting for? Book your tickets today and experience all that this beautiful island has to offer. For more places, visit Journey Index frequently.